401 STOREFRONT SERIES

The 400 Aluminum Storefront Series is a cost-effective center-glazed system meticulously crafted to meet industry-standard performance requirements efficiently. Notably, all components of this system are designed for interchangeability, rendering it well-suited for both interior and exterior applications.

Measuring 1 ¾” x 4”, the 400 Series is a robust glazing system capable of accommodating ¼” glass within a ½” glass pocket width, offering flexibility for both shop and field fabrication. Extrusions can be reinforced to adhere to more demanding performance standards. This aluminum storefront series seamlessly integrates with all standard entrance door hardware, accommodating various door types, including those with single or double-action door hardware.

The mockup specimen for testing was a flat wall specimen, nominal one (1) story high, consisting of a 4 1/2″ deep, offset glazed, aluminum window wall system, measuring approx, 10´ wide by 10´ high (3 lites wide by 2 lites high). The system was glazed.

Compliance Statement: Results obtained are tested values and were secured by using the designated test method(s). The samples tested met the performance requeriments set forth in the referenced test procedures for a +1676/-2873 Pa (+35/-60psf) Design Pressure with missile impacts corresponding to Missile Level D and Wind Zone 3 for a basic protection rating.
